E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
随机化快排
215. 数组中的第K个最大元素
){priority_queue,greater>q;for(inti=0;iq.top()){q.pop();q.push(nums[i]);}}}returnq.top();}};思路2:快速选择
快排
的基础上改进
hoshii77
·
2023-03-25 03:57
面试题40. 最小的k个数
原题https://leetcode-cn.com/problems/zui-xiao-de-kge-shu-lcof/解题思路利用
快排
的思想,每经过一轮排序,pivot左边的一定是较小的,右边的一定是较大的
最尾一名
·
2023-03-24 21:29
单链表实现直接插入排序(JAVA)
去面试问了单链表实现
快排
的问题,所以想来把八大排序算法的单链表实现总结一下。这篇就先总结直接插入排序。
Bamboooooo_Yoo
·
2023-03-24 17:22
探究一下C语言生成随机数的奥秘
随机数可以用于密码学、
随机化
算法、统计分析、模拟等多种场景。以下是一些应用场景的例子:密码学:随机数在密码学中被广泛使用,例如生成随机密钥或者初始化向量。
·
2023-03-23 20:26
算法设计可练习题One
1.众数问题(分治法)(1)法一:分治法(借助快速排序的思想)思路:a.随机选取一个pivoty,然后利用
快排
思想找到其对应顺序的位置,同时在遍历的过程中计算Pivoty的重数sum。
一只呆桃酱
·
2023-03-23 20:40
基础算法
算法
哈希算法
盘点2022年孟德尔
随机化
高分文章
都2022年了,竟然还有孟德尔
随机化
能发IF>10的文章!!!敲黑板,重点:所用数据全都是公共数据,完全可以复现!!!
rapunzel0103
·
2023-03-23 18:44
养生小知识 带脉穴
【养生】做腹部按摩大家可以在空闲时间按摩下自己的腹部,这样可以提高肠胃功能,可以改善便秘情况,建议:按摩“带脉穴”能够帮助加
快排
毒,改善便秘。位于人体腹部两侧,侧卧时大概在肚脐左右各5厘米的位置。
向新_45ea
·
2023-03-23 06:47
孟德尔
随机化
法(Mendelian randomization method)
这篇笔记的基础来自一篇中文文献,《孟德尔
随机化
法在因果推断中的应用》。英文来源:http://www.mend
又是一只小菜鸟
·
2023-03-23 02:05
Python实现快速排序
一、代码如下1、
快排
函数defquick_sort(array):iflen(array)pivot]returnquick_sort(less)+[pivot]+quick_sort(greater)
liveshow021_jxb
·
2023-03-23 02:35
Python
基础知识
算法
排序算法
python
14 | 排序优化:如何实现一个通用的、高性能的排序函数?
快排
在最坏情况下的时间复杂度是O()感谢极客时间:https://
那年_匆匆
·
2023-03-22 15:18
jmeter(压力测试)指标分析-猫神
压测任务需求的确认压测前要明确压测功能和压测指标,一般需要确定的几个问题:固定接口参数进行压测还是进行接口参数
随机化
压测?要求支持多少并发数?TPS(每秒钟处理事务数)目标多少?响应时间要达到多
爱吃草的猫_4551
·
2023-03-21 21:57
生娃小结~
此时腺管未通畅,要做的是给宝宝早吸吮,如果宝宝没在身边,用双边吸奶器去刺激,而不能着急下奶,吃鸡汤鱼汤鸽子汤,以防堵奶2.排便从产前半个月开始,饮食要清淡,保持大便通畅,如果是剖腹产,也可以促使产后尽
快排
气产后第二天不管是否有便意
举书
·
2023-03-20 18:39
捋捋工作头绪
前室扩散室-INGE除尘前室-INGG滤毒室_INGI密闭通道——等待4、名称添加:全有-等待5、面积添加B防化室-等待6、检查全有【X】【x】-等待【a】【A】-等待【h】【H】-等待【s】【S】-等待二、
快排
一
范兰英
·
2023-03-20 08:30
遗传算法实例解析(python)
遗传算法以一种群体中的所有个体为对象,并利用
随机化
技术指导对一个被编码的参数空间进行高效搜索。
cocajoo
·
2023-03-20 07:24
算法
遗传算法
python
代码
iOS逆向----查看APP是否开启了完整的ASLR
在iOS4.3中,苹果引入了地址空间布局
随机化
也就是ASLR。
捡书
·
2023-03-20 07:50
JS版本 排序算法
1.三种排序--冒泡,选择排序,
快排
varmm=[9,5,10,2,7,6,2]//冒泡排序稳定n的平方functionbubble(arr){vartempfor(vari=0,length=arr.length
翩翩公子银圈圈
·
2023-03-20 05:52
快速排序【算法解析,代码模板】
快排
的思想是基于分治思想的一种排序方法,核心思路分为以下几步:①确定左右边界l和r②设置x,值可以是q[l],q[r]或者q[(l+r)/2]③递归排序左右区间我们可能并不清楚x到底在待排数组的哪个位置
qq_22841387
·
2023-03-19 22:59
PTA
算法
c++
数据结构
寻找第k大的数
目录:1、引子2、排序解决法3、类
快排
解法4、最小堆解法1、引子日常编码中,常见遇到这样的问题,“寻找最大的数”,此问题非常容易,可暴力直接遍历找出,也可使用分冶策略找出最大值(详见分冶算法)。
某昆
·
2023-03-19 20:00
06-20:刷题综合三:
快排
快排
:1、快速排序2、快速排序寻找第K个大3、最小的K个数1、手写
快排
算法classSolution:defMySort(self,arr):#writecodehereifnotarr:returndefq_sort
是黄小胖呀
·
2023-03-18 20:27
2018-09-18 招银网络面试
快排
怎么让其变得稳定?3.两个文档分别包括51条,如何找出相同的条目。有一点需要注意就是不能同时将两个文档读进内存,内存有限。
Jeo_zhao
·
2023-03-18 17:41
校运会
演完后,我们赶
快排
队。然后,我们坐下来看其他班表演。表演后我们升国旗。我们一边唱国歌,一边看着鲜艳的红旗迎风飘扬。唱完国歌后,我们听黄校长讲话。一会儿我听见,我们二二班的张峻瑜来说话。他说
悦宁_4bfd
·
2023-03-17 23:37
14.如何把百万级别订单根据金额排序
快排
、归并是经济实用型小轿车。而桶排序、计数
MageByte_青叶
·
2023-03-17 13:26
02
要求额外空间复杂度O(1),时间复杂度O(N)这就引到了
快排
的思想。本文叙述一下解决问题
ShawnCaffeine
·
2023-03-17 08:33
冒泡, 选择, 归并,
快排
, 计数, 插入 排序
跳舞演示排序https://zhuanlan.zhihu.com/p/492711891.冒泡排序时间复杂度:O(n^2)空间复杂度:O(1)defbubble_sort(nums):foriinrange(len(nums)-1):forjinrange(len(nums)-i-1):ifnums[j]>nums[j+1]:nums[j],nums[j+1]=nums[j+1],nums[j]2
火鸡不肥
·
2023-03-17 03:26
微软校园招聘笔试题
3,4},{6,5},{2,7},{3,1},{1,2}}下面哪一个是函数调用之后的结果{{1,2},{2,7},{3,1},{3,4},{6,5}}f1:选择排序;f2:直接插入排序;f3:冒泡,f4:
快排
Sep_D_Dai
·
2023-03-17 03:25
手撸排序:快速排序
沉迷猴姆拉无法自拔核心思想首先算法理解了主要思想,那么代码实现也是信手拈来
快排
分以下三步:找基准:挑一个基准数用来分割当前数组,我们称该数为"基准"(pivot)分割:把数组里小于"基准"的数放到左边,
野兽仙贝
·
2023-03-17 02:09
dirsearch命令详解
dirsearch拥有以下特点:多线程可保持连接支持多种后缀(-e|–extensionsasp,php)生成报告(纯文本,JSON)启发式检测无效的网页递归的暴力扫描支持HTTP代理用户代理
随机化
批量处理请求延迟扫描器与字典字典必须是文本文件
ADLAB
·
2023-03-16 21:16
前端算法总结
//
快排
functionQuickSort(arr,left,right){if(left>=right){return;}varpivot_index=Partion(arr,left,right);
卓然凌昭
·
2023-03-16 21:36
不要再忘记
快排
了
引子快速排序是一个很难记的概念,倒不是说排序方法难记,就是为什么叫快速排序,到底快在哪儿,说不清楚。回味归并排序数组对半分,不停对半分直到数组长度为1,即已排好,因为长度为1根本不用排用merge将两个长度为1的数组合并,并排好序用merge将两个长度为2的数字合并,并排好序……a1..n,n=1sort(a1,...,an){a1>a2?[a2,a1]:[a1:a2],n=2merge(sort
_刘小c
·
2023-03-16 15:59
排序算法之插入排序
对pivot的选择,影响到
快排
的时间复杂度。本文我们将讨论插入排序。插入排序非常简单,对小的数据量很高效稳定,且只需要O(1)的辅助空间。但其时间复杂度为O(n^2),在最好的情况下达到O(n)。
落日无风
·
2023-03-16 00:37
958硕士怎么面试京东 、华为、去哪儿总结(3个offer)
6.算法的时间复杂度和空间复杂度的含义,分析一下
快排
的?7.MySQL
CPP高级框架师
·
2023-03-15 20:47
快排
(python)
defquick_sort(a):iflen(a)prv]returnquick_sort(left)+[prv]+quick_sort(right)#第一种代码简单,但是需要额外占用空间,空间复杂度高!defquicksort(a,begin,end):ifbeginright时停止循环,此时将prv与right的位置交换whileleftprv:right-=1whileleftright:b
人工智障007
·
2023-03-15 20:31
解析游戏中的简单概率算法
概率算法也叫
随机化
算法。概率算法允许算法在执行过程中随机地选择下一个计算步骤。在很多情况下,算法在执行过程中面临选择时,随机性选择比最优选择省时,因此概率算法可以在很大程度上降低算法的复杂度。
霜迟Boan
·
2023-03-15 13:03
算法
算法
c++
简单加权
随机化
算法的实现 带使用案例
加权
随机化
是一种从列表中随机选择元素的方法,其中每个元素具有不同的权重,以确定其被选择的概率。
Taylor 淡定哥
·
2023-03-15 13:32
python
人工智能
Unity实用插件篇 ✨ | 游戏中的求概率插件WeightedRandomization加权
随机化
算法
博客主页:https://xiaoy.blog.csdn.net本文由呆呆敲代码的小Y原创学习专栏推荐:Unity系统学习专栏游戏制作专栏推荐:游戏制作Unity实战100例专栏推荐:Unity实战100例教程欢迎点赞收藏⭐留言如有错误敬请指正!未来很长,值得我们全力奔赴更美好的生活✨------------------❤️分割线❤️-------------------------前言Unity
呆呆敲代码的小Y
·
2023-03-15 13:30
Unity
实用插件集合篇
unity
游戏
游戏引擎
游戏概率
概率
重感冒如何尽快好转?
1、尽
快排
除病毒西医说感冒的致病原因是病毒,而病毒至今没有特效药,所以你就不必去想着用吃药解决,最好最有效的方法就是多吃新鲜的橙子,大量喝温开水,一天喝上几大杯的温开水,多上几次厕所,是排出病毒最有效的方法
麒麟火云流量哥
·
2023-03-15 01:18
整理的Python语法速览与实战清单,零基础注意查收!
譬如我们用Python实现的简易的
快排
相较于Java会显得很短小精悍:控制台交互可以根据name关键字来判断是否是直接使用python命令执行某个脚本,还是外部引用
老程序员的最大爱好
·
2023-03-14 22:03
程序员
python
开发语言
java
python教程
python3.11
插入排序VS冒泡排序
我们讲解的顺序按照时间复杂度来分,分成了3类,见下表——章节排序算法时间复杂度是否基于比较一冒泡、插入、选择O(n^2)是二
快排
、归并O(nlogn)是三桶、计数、基数O(n)否首先像一个问题,为什么插入排序比冒泡排序火呢
StevenHD
·
2023-03-14 21:06
快速排序
1.标准
快排
:选取数组第一个数为基准数。(这种方法的缺点在于对于基本有序的序列排序反而很慢)2.改进
快排
:选取数组中间的数为基准数,比普通
快排
要快
CPPZWW
·
2023-03-14 18:46
一行代码-杀手级的 JS
数组乱序在使用需要某种程度的
随机化
的算法时,你会经常发现洗牌数组是一个相当必要的技能。下面的片段以O(nlogn)的复杂度对一个数组进行就地洗牌。
赵客缦胡缨v吴钩霜雪明
·
2023-03-14 06:24
分治--寻找第k小元素(元素可重复),复杂度O(n)
其他方法:如果直接对序列排序求最小值,复杂度为nlogn;如果直接套用
快排
的思想来做的话,最优情况为O(n),最坏为O(n2)分治法的阈值:我们有一种吊炸天的分治算法,可以用很好的效率求解出某个问题,分治算法当然在达到一个非常小的规模时
科研的心
·
2023-03-13 19:02
数据结构与算法:快速排序
经典
快排
首先任意选取一个数据作为关键数据,然后将所有比它小的数都放到它左边,所有比它大的数都放到它右边,这个过程称为一趟快速排序。
我爱铲屎
·
2023-03-13 19:42
Java面试题—数据结构篇
说几种排序算法(
快排
、堆排、归并)十大经典排序算法(Python实现)
但偏偏雨渐渐丶
·
2023-03-13 16:02
Java下的Arrays排序sort算法源码解析(下)
知识回顾在上一章节中,我们介绍了关于Java下的Arrays排序sort算法的数组长度不超过QUICKSORT_THRESHOLD数值为286时的算法应用,分别有插入排序,双轴
快排
,单轴
快排
和结对插入排序
向光奔跑_
·
2023-03-13 12:14
赵薇胖的时候既然长这样? 每天喝这个, 身体美的不要不要的, 想瘦就瘦
赵薇:喝柠檬水刮油,一月瘦22斤柠檬富含柠檬酸有助消化,含丰富的维生素C,还含有有益血管健康的抗氧化剂,能促进肠道蠕动,加
快排
便。按照赵薇的话来说,有强大的“刮油”效果。
快乐瘦瘦方
·
2023-03-13 05:08
58二面(5.9)
问我在ACM学到什么
快排
和堆排讲过程和对比,和大数据情况下。TOPK问题求区间最大值two-pointers。斐波那契数列第n项递归,非递归,矩阵快速幂。
__Kirito_
·
2023-03-13 00:05
电脑裸奔必备沙盒工具之【Sandboxie v5.26直装版】
它还可以
随机化
您的IP地址并进
开心玩机
·
2023-03-12 13:12
有相关性就有因果关系吗,教你玩转孟德尔
随机化
分析(mendelian randomization )
流行病学研究常见的分析就是相关性分析了。相关性分析某种程度上可以为我们提供一些研究思路,比如缺乏元素A与某种癌症相关,那么我们可以通过补充元素A来减少患癌率。这个结论的大前提是缺乏元素A会导致这种癌症,也就是说元素A和癌症有因果关系。但实际上,元素A和癌症有相关性,不代表他们之间就有因果关系。也有可能是患癌症的人同时有其他的并发症,这种并发症会导致元素A缺乏。再比如,研究表明,大胸女生与不爱运动相
橙子牛奶糖
·
2023-03-12 13:09
算法第四版笔记(排序)
插入排序:147.InsertionSortList
快排
:148.SortList148这题要求复杂度为nlogn所以就想到用快速排序做,将第一个节点作为partition,大于等于partition的放在一个链表中
呜哩哇啦0_0
·
2023-03-11 12:06
1005 继续(3n+1)猜想
1005继续3n+1猜想题目描述解题思路代码实现(以思路1为例)(本次以
快排
的方式实现题目描述点击直达题目链接解题思路两个思路:1.先排序,再剔除验证时重复的。2.先剔除验证时重复的,再排序。
easy_understand-ML
·
2023-03-10 18:25
#
PAT乙级刷题笔记
c语言
开发语言
后端
上一页
21
22
23
24
25
26
27
28
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他